Overview

As a freelancer and at Harlequin's Carina Press imprint, I've worked with top-notch indie and traditionally published authors on more than a hundred genre novels, including New York Times and USA Today bestsellers. My clients have sold hundreds of thousands of books on Kindle (Jennifer Foehner Wells), landed agency representation and traditional publishing deals (Wayne Santos), and made the New York Times bestseller list (Felix R. Savage) after working with me. No matter where you are on your publishing journey, I can help you get better.


Whether I'm coaching or editing, I look to help authors answer three key questions: What are they writing? Why is it exciting? And what do they need to do it better? I always put the client first, and I make sure I identify what's working well and how we can strengthen it as well as what isn't working.


Working with me is a collaborative experience. In my coaching calls, we start with how you're doing and work together on the need of the moment. In my editorial evaluations and manuscript notes, I explain potential issues and ask questions to help you engage with your work more deeply. Ultimately, I want to help you improve from book to book until you meet your goals, whether that means writing bestselling thrillers, award-winning literary fiction, heartrendingly beautiful experiments in storytelling, or something else. I am a member of the Science Fiction and Fantasy Writers of America (SFWA), and as an author myself (published indie and with Penguin Random House), I aim to be a writer's dream editor.


Helping authors succeed is the most fun part of my career. I love unraveling knotty questions of structure and characterization, teaching early career authors the tricks of the trade, helping veterans break new ground, and polishing prose until it gleams. I begin every project with the same enthusiasm I felt as a kid at the library, and I'd love to take a look at yours.

Work experience

Harlequin/Carina Press

Nov, 2011 — Oct, 2014 (almost 3 years)

Acquiring editor for Harlequin's digital-first imprint Carina Press as it built its sci-fi and fantasy list. Responsible for finding books, pitching them for acquisition, working with authors to edit them, developing series, and shepherding books through publication.
